On Wednesday the Facebook’s Developers Conference f8 took place and was streamed live via livesteam. Mark Zuckerberg, CEO of Facebook, announced several new features including: one step permissions, saved caches, Facebook currency (Credits), and the social graph (Open Graph protocol). Location has a been a hot topic lately as mobile applications and advertising platforms continue to arise. SimpleGeo, a Boulder, Colorado based startup founded by Matt Galligan (formerly of SocialThing) and Joe Stump (formerly of Digg) looks to help make adding location based services and data to your applications a breeze.
